Australia Quote by Donna Karan
“You look at the world situation, look at London, Paris, Italy, it is all basically the same as the U.S. Then you look at other places such as India, Bali, with warmer climates, you know the Southern climates, they are very different. I think there is a time and place for everything and in Australia, for example, it is completely the opposite. I don't think we can be designing for that customer per se.”
About This Quote
The quote observes that cultural and climatic contexts shape consumer needs, implying design must adapt to regional differences rather than assume uniformity.
In simple terms: Design must fit local cultures and climates.
